1. What is Mass Percent Concentration?

Mass percent concentration (or mass percentage) is a way of expressing the concentration of a component in a mixture. It represents the mass of the solute divided by the total mass of the solution, multiplied by 100%.

2. How Does the Calculator Work?

The calculator uses the mass percent formula:

\[ \text{Mass\%} = \left( \frac{\text{mass solute}}{\text{mass solution}} \right) \times 100 \]

Where:

Explanation: The formula calculates what percentage of the total solution's mass comes from the solute.

3. Importance of Mass Percent

Details: Mass percent is commonly used in chemistry for preparing solutions, especially when precise concentrations are needed for reactions or experiments.

5. Frequently Asked Questions (FAQ)

Q1: What's the difference between mass percent and volume percent?
A: Mass percent uses mass measurements (grams), while volume percent uses volume measurements (mL or L). Mass percent is preferred when dealing with solids or when temperature affects volume.

Q2: Can mass percent exceed 100%?
A: No, mass percent cannot exceed 100% as the solute mass cannot be greater than the total solution mass.

Q3: When is mass percent most useful?
A: Mass percent is particularly useful when working with solid-solid mixtures or when precise mass measurements are available.

Q4: How does this differ from molarity?
A: Molarity considers the number of moles per liter of solution, while mass percent considers the mass ratio regardless of molecular weight or volume.

Q5: What are common applications of mass percent?
A: Common applications include preparing chemical solutions, alloy compositions, and reporting nutritional information on food labels.
